Multiscale_Waste_PlasticObs_plus

Description

Abstract:

The dataset developed within the PlasticObs+ project aims to facilitate a multiscale approach for detecting and quantifying environmental waste. Traditional detection methods often suffer from narrow, use-case specific limitations, reducing their transferability. To address this, a dataset was created featuring various spatial and spectral resolutions. The highest spatial resolution images (Ground Sampling Distance 0.2cm) were used to generate a labeled dataset, which is georeferenced for mapping onto coarser resolution images.
